TP官方网址下载 _tp官方下载安卓最新版本|IOS版/最新app-tpwallet
以下内容以TPWallet钱包DApp为中心,围绕“数字货币支付解决方案趋势、新兴科技趋势、网络传输、行业研究、高效支付技术服务管理、便捷支付系统、安全验证”等方面做综合性讲解。由于不同链生态与业务形态差异较大,本文采用通用架构视角,帮助你把握设计要点与落地路径。
一、数字货币支付解决方案趋势:从“能收”到“好用、可控、可扩展”
数字货币支付的演进可以概括为三段式:
1)早期阶段:完成转账与到账可见性
- 核心诉求是“交易能发出、地址能生成、链上可追踪”。
- 用户体验多停留在区块浏览器层面。
2)中期阶段:围绕支付链路构建“业务化能力”
- 引入支付单(Payment Intent/Order)概念:把“链上交易”与“商户订单”绑定。
- 强调链上与链下对账:例如回执、确认次数、失败回滚策略。
- 通过聚合路由或跨链支持提升币种覆盖与可用性。
3)当前趋势:以安全、效率与合规/风控为前提的“综合支付体验”
- 去中心化能力与中心化体验并行:例如用托管/托管式流程提升成功率,但用更强的权限与审计控制降低风险。
- 更细粒度的风控:地址信誉、风险交易特征、异常地理位置/设备指纹等。
- 面向商户的SLA与可观测性:延迟、失败率、平均确认时间、重试策略等指标进入工程化管理。
在TPWallet钱包DApp的实践中,支付解决方案通常会围绕:
- 多链资产管理(余额查询、资产展示、币种选择)
- 支付意图与回调(生成支付单→发起交易→监听确认→回传结果)
- 失败与重试(例如Gas波动导致失败、网络拥堵导致确认延迟)
进行组合式构建。
二、新兴科技趋势:让支付更“智能”、更“自动化”
新兴科技主要体现在三类:
1)账户抽象与智能化钱包(Account Abstraction/Smart Accounts)
- 让交易发起从“必须手动签名单笔交易”变为“可组合的意图/策略执行”。
- 支持批量操作、会话密钥(Session Key)、更细的权限控制。
- 用户体验会更接近传统支付:确认更少、失败更少、体验更一致。
2)跨链与意图式路由(Intent/Router)
- 不仅跨链转账,还要跨链“支付完成”——即商户侧不关心中间路由。

- 路由引擎根据滑点、手续费、可用流动性、确认速度选择策略。
3)隐私与安全计算(在不牺牲可审计性的前提下)
- 某些业务希望降低敏感信息暴露,但仍要满足审计/合规需求。
- 实际落地可能采用更保守的方式:交易信息仍公开,业务层采用权限与最小化数据暴露。
TPWallet DApp可把这些趋势体现在:
- 用更智能的“支付流程编排”减少用户操作
- 用路由/聚合降低链切换成本
- 用会话密钥或权限边界提升安全性与可恢复性
三、网络传输:保证“速度、可靠性与可观测性”
支付链路的网络传输包含多层:
- DApp前端到业务服务(API调用)
- 业务服务到链节点/网关(RPC/Relay)
- DApp或服务监听链上事件(WebSocket/轮询/事件索引器)
- 跨域回调与商户侧对账(webhook/回调API)
关键挑战:
1)延迟与抖动(Latency/Jitter)
- 链上确认时间不确定,网络抖动会影响轮询频率与回调时机。
- 解决:自适应重试、动态轮询间隔、超时与兜底策略。
2)一致性(Consistency)
- 同一支付单可能经历“已广播→未确认→重组/失败→最终确认/失败”的状态变化。
- 解决:采用状态机(State Machine)统一状态转换规则,避免前端与后端状态不一致。
3)带宽与吞吐(Throughput)
- 高并发下RPC/网关成为瓶颈。
- 解决:缓存、批量查询、事件索引器、限流与熔断。
对TPWallet钱包DApp的建议:
- 用“事件驱动”优先监听确认结果,同时保留轮询兜底。
- 对关键请求(发起交易、确认回调)进行幂等设计:同一订单多次调用不会产生重复交易。
- 记录链上TxHash、订单号、签名参数摘要、时间戳,形成可观测链路。
四、行业研究视角:从用户体验到工程与合规的平衡
从行业研究角度,数字货币支付的采用受多因素影响:
1)用户侧
- 学习成本:地址、Gas、链切换等是否被隐藏。
- 成功率与到账时间可预期性。
- 失败时的解释与补救(如何补签、如何重试、如何退款/更换币种)。
2)商户侧
- 对账成本:是否能自动生成对账报表。
- 稳定性:是否有高可用链路与监控告警。
- 结算与风控:价格波动对冲策略、异常订单处理。
3)技术与生态侧
- 生态兼容:多链资产与多钱包互操作。
- 开发成本:接入门槛、SDK成熟度、文档质量。
TPWallet DApp的研究落点通常是:
- 以“支付体验”为核心指标:例如平均完成时间、失败率、用户操作步骤数。
- 以“工程可靠性”为约束:幂等、重试、状态机、审计日志。
- 以“安全验证”为底线:签名安全、权限边界与反欺诈。
五、高效支付技术服务管理:把支付当作“可运营系统”
支付系统不是一次性开发,而是持续运营的服务。高效支付技术服务管理可以从以下维度构建:
1)支付状态机与幂等
- 定义订单状态:创建→待签名→待链上确认→已确认→失败/取消。
- 所有关键动作(创建订单、发起交易、回调商户)要幂等,避免重复广播。
2)重试与降级策略
- Gas失败:可换用更合理的gas策略或重签(取决于钱包机制)。
- 超时:将订单转入“待确认”并在后台持续监听,前端不重复触发。
- 链拥堵:切换到更可用的链/路由或延后确认策略。
3)资源与成本管理
- 监控RPC调用成本、失败率、平均确认耗时。
- 对查询类请求做缓存(余额、币种列表等)。
- 对链上事件监听进行集中管理,减少重复订阅。
4)监控与告警
- 指标:成功率、平均/分位延迟(P50/P95/P99)、回调成功率、链上确认失败原因分布。
- 告警:当失败率或延迟超过阈值时自动降级(例如暂停新订单或切换路由)。
TPWallet DApp中,可把这些能力封装为:
- 统一支付服务(Payment Service)
- 统一监听与回调服务(Listener/Webhook Service)
- 统一审计日志与风控服务(Audit/Fraud Service)
六、便捷支付系统:降低用户操作,让支付像“点一下就完成”
便捷支付系统的关键在“减少步骤、降低认知负担、提高可控性”。常见优化包括:
1)无缝币种选择与估算
- 自动推荐支付币种(考虑用户钱包余额与链手续费)。
- 实时估算:到账金额、手续费范围、预计确认时间区间。
2)支付意图与一键流程
- 用户只需确认一次关键参数(金额、收款/商户信息)。
- 钱包侧签名与交易细节对用户尽可能透明。
3)快速确认与用户反馈
- 交易广播后立即给“进行中”状态。
- 提供明确提示:需要等待多少确认次数、何时会自动更新。
4)失败补救体验
- 失败原因提示(网络拥堵、gas不足、链错误等)。
- 提供“重试/换链/换币种”的引导,而不是让用户回到复杂配置。
结合TPWallet钱包DApp,可以将前端体验设计为:
- 选择商品/金额→生成支付单→请求钱包授权/签名→提交后展示状态面板→链上确认自动刷新→回调商户并展示结果。
七、安全验证:从签名到交易、从前端到服务端的多层防护
安全验证是支付系统的核心。建议采用“多层、可验证、可追溯”的策略。
1)签名与密钥安全
- 不在前端暴露私钥;私钥始终由钱包托管或在安全环境完成签名。
- 对签名请求进行参数校验:金额、收款地址、链Id、nonce/有效期等。
2)参数防篡改与交易意图绑定
- 将订单号、商户信息、金额、链路策略等打包为不可变的支付意图。
- 服务器端再次校验意图与链上交易字段是否一致,防止被替换为其他地址或金额。
3)重放攻击与幂等保护
- 通过nonce、订单有效期、签名域分离(domain separation)等手段降低重放风险。

- 所有回调接口与交易广播接口必须幂等。
4)网络与接口安全
- API鉴权(Token/签名)、限流、验证码或风控策略(对高频失败行为)。
- 对webhook回调验证签名,防止伪造商户通知。
5)链上验证与审计
- 监听合约事件/转账记录,确认:TxHash、接收地址、金额、确认次数。
- 保留审计日志:谁发起、何时发起、请求参数摘要、链上最终结果。
在TPWallet钱包DApp的安全落地上,可形成“安全验证链路”示例:
- 前端:展示与签名前校验关键字段
- DApp后端:对支付单状态与参数进行二次校验
- 链监听:核对链上事实与支付单绑定关系
- 回调:商户侧验签与幂等处理
结语:用“架构能力”统一支付体验、效率与安全
综合来看,TPWallet钱包DApp的支付落地不是单点功能,而是一个系统工程:
- 以支付意图与状态机实现可控与可追踪
- 以网络传输策略实现高性能与可靠性
- 以服务管理实现可运营与可扩展
- 以便捷支付系统提升用户体验
- 以安全验证多层防护守住底线
若你希望我进一步把以上内容“落到具体实现”,你可以告诉我:你要做的是“转账式支付(发币到商户地址)”还是“合约/聚合支付(可能涉及路由、换币、跨链)”,以及目标链与预计日均交易量,我可以给出更贴近工程的架构图、状态机定义与接口设计要点。